The EAGLE CUTTING TOOL VM4350-024-6-D is a carbide-tipped masonry drill bit designed for drilling into concrete, block, brick, and other masonry materials. The bit measures 3/8 inch in diameter with a 6-inch overall length (OAL), giving technicians and tradespeople the reach needed for deeper anchor holes and through-wall applications. The carbide tip provides the hardness required to cut through abrasive masonry without rapid dulling. This bit is manufactured in the USA and is suited for use by electricians, plumbers, HVAC installers, and general contractors who regularly drill into masonry substrates during rough-in and finish work.
This masonry drill bit is appropriate for residential and light commercial applications where anchor bolts, conduit sleeves, pipe penetrations, or equipment mounting points must be drilled through concrete block, poured concrete, or brick. The 6-inch OAL makes it practical for both standard and slightly extended-reach drilling tasks without requiring an extension. It fits standard rotary hammer and hammer drill chucks designed for 3/8-inch shank tooling.
Designed for use in hammer drills and rotary hammers that accept a 3/8-inch shank masonry bit. Suitable for drilling concrete, brick, block, and similar masonry substrates in typical trade installation scenarios.

Always use the appropriate hammer drill or rotary hammer setting for masonry — avoid running the bit in rotation-only mode against hard concrete, as this will damage the carbide tip. Wear appropriate eye protection and a dust mask when drilling masonry. Confirm the drilling path is clear of embedded rebar, conduit, or wiring before starting.
